La importancia de llamarse Ernesto y la gilipollez de llamarse Eric
He was born in Granada, the only city in the world with an explosive name. At the age of ten he joined the Falange because he wanted to play the drum. His biggest musical influences have been Holy Week and his first host, the one he was given at birth. It was produced at the age of sixteen. A little later he began using drugs to escape. he should have died before thirty. For forty years he has hit the drums as life has hit him, with all his might.
